Location is key, and 139 Wood sits in Hamilton's North End, just steps from Pier 8, the centerpiece of the West Harbour waterfront redevelopment. This transformative project is set to introduce approximately 1,500 new residential units, retail space, 1.6 km of scenic waterfront walkways, public plazas, and parks, creating a vibrant, pedestrian-friendly waterfront community. A 45-storey landmark tower has already been approved, further signaling the area's exciting growth and future value appreciation. North End, Hamilton is a west GTA neighbourhood notable for its singles, renters and salespeople. It has a higher than average population of immigrants, particularly those from Portugal, and Portuguese speakers. Residents tend to be younger with a significant number of babies, kids aged 5 to 14 and adults aged 25 to 44.
